This 179 square meter detached bungalow in Nash, Milton Keynes, was built between 1996-2002. It features fully double-glazed windows and has a 'C' energy rating. The property has a current energy consumption of 105 units and a potential energy consumption of 27 units. The EPC rating is expected to be 'A' in the future. The property has a current CO2 emission of 3.2 and a potential CO2 emission of 0.8. It has 6 heated rooms, 6 fireplaces, and a main heating control system. The property's main fuel is electricity, and the current heating costs are £2,512. - Based on our analysis, this property has a HomeScore of 873 out of 999.
